Improving the market success of Ethiopian farmers in dairy value chains
Speaking at the opening of the National dairy forum on 23 November 2010, improving market success of Ethiopian farmers (IPMS) Project Manager, Dirk Hoekstra presented some IPMS experiences in the research for development in the dairy value chain.
